Regional differences in the prevalence and influencing factors of hypertension amongst people over 40 years old in Anhui Province

目的 了解分析安徽省皖北、皖中、皖南三个地区≥40岁人群高血压患病率、意识率、控制率差异及相关危险因素,为不同地区高血压防治提供针对性意见。 方法 以长江、淮河为界,将安徽省分为皖北、皖南、皖中3个地区。采用多阶段分层整群抽样方法,通过问卷调查和体格测量对2015年安徽省≥40岁人群高血压患病、知晓、控制情况以及相关影响因素进行调查。采用χ2检验分析高血压加权患病率、意识率和控制率的地区差异,加权logistic逐步回归分析高血压危险因素,logistic逐步回归分析高血压知晓率和控制率的影响因素。 结果 共纳入2 967名≥40岁的居民。安徽省高血压总体患病率为37.7%(皖中40.1%、皖北38.6%、皖南34.3%),皖北≥60岁人群高血压患病率明显高于皖中、皖南。本次调查高血压知晓率为52.5%,控制率为18.6%,3个地区间差异有统计学意义。皖南高血压知晓率是皖中2.19倍,控制率是其3.88倍,远高于皖北(均P < 0.05)。 结论 安徽省≥40岁人群高血压患病率较高,且皖北高血压控制率远低于皖南,年龄、BMI、文化程度均是影响高血压患病率和控制率的因素。安徽省南北地区、城乡预防卫生保健水平存在较大差异。 Abstract:Objective To analyse the differences in the prevalence, awareness rate, control rate and related risk factors of hypertension amongst people aged ≥ 40 years in North Anhui, Central Anhui and South Anhui and provide targeted suggestions for hypertension prevention and treatment in different regions. Methods Using the Yangtze and the Huaihe River as the boundary, Anhui Province was divided into three areas: North Anhui, South Anhui and Central Anhui. Multi-stage stratified cluster sampling was used to investigate the prevalence, awareness, control and related factors of hypertension in Anhui Province in 2015 using a questionnaire survey and physical measurement. χ2 test was used to analyse the regional differences in the weighted prevalence rate, awareness rate and control rate of hypertension. In addition, weighty logistic stepwise regression was conducted to analyse the risk factors of hypertension. Logistic stepwise regression was used to analyse the influencing factors of hypertension awareness and control rate. Results A total of 2 967 residents aged ≥ 40 years were included in this study. The overall prevalence of hypertension in Anhui Province was 37.7% (40.1% in Central Anhui, 38.6% in North Anhui and 34.3% in South Anhui). The prevalence of hypertension in people aged ≥ 60 years in North Anhui was significantly higher than that in Central Anhui and South Anhui. The awareness rate of hypertension was 52.5%, and the control rate was 18.6%. The difference amongst the three regions was statistically significant. The awareness rate and control rate of hypertension in South Anhui were 2.19 times and 3.88 times as high as those in Central Anhui, which were higher than those in North Anhui, and this difference was significant (all P < 0.05). Conclusion The prevalence of hypertension amongst people aged ≥ 40 years was high in Anhui Province, and the control rate of hypertension in North Anhui was lower than that in South Anhui. Age, BMI and the level of education were considered as factors affecting the prevalence and control rate of hypertension. Great differences in the level of preventive health care were found between North and South of Anhui Province and between urban and rural areas. -
